1. 背景介绍
Linux系统是一种高度自由和强大的操作系统,但随着时间的推移和系统的使用,垃圾文件和临时文件的积累可能会影响系统性能。因此,定期清理垃圾文件是保持系统健康运行的重要任务之一。
2. 检查磁盘空间
2.1 查找占用磁盘空间的目录
在开始清理垃圾文件之前,首先需要检查系统中哪些目录占用了大量的磁盘空间。可以使用以下命令来列出各个目录的磁盘使用情况:
du -sh *
这个命令将列出所有目录的磁盘使用情况,包括子目录。您可以根据列出的结果确定哪些目录占用了较多的磁盘空间。
2.2 列出大文件
大文件也可能会占用大量磁盘空间。可以使用以下命令列出指定目录中的大文件:
find /path/to/directory -type f -size +100M
以上命令将列出指定目录中大小超过100MB的文件。您可以根据实际需求调整文件大小的限制。
3. 清理临时文件
3.1 清理临时目录
系统中的临时目录可能会积累大量不再需要的临时文件。您可以使用以下命令定期清理临时目录:
sudo rm -rf /tmp/*
这个命令将删除临时目录中的所有文件和子目录。
3.2 清理用户临时目录
每个用户在主目录下也有一个临时目录,用于存储临时文件。可以使用以下命令清理用户临时目录:
sudo rm -rf /home/user/tmp/*
将上述命令中的"user"替换为实际的用户名。
4. 清理日志文件
4.1 清理系统日志
系统日志文件可能会占用大量的磁盘空间。可以使用以下命令清理系统日志:
sudo rm -rf /var/log/*
这个命令将删除/var/log目录下的所有日志文件。
4.2 清理应用程序日志
各个应用程序可能会创建自己的日志文件。可以使用以下命令来清理特定应用程序的日志:
sudo rm -rf /path/to/application/log/files/*
将上述命令中的"/path/to/application/log/files/"替换为实际的应用程序日志文件的路径。
5. 清理缓存文件
5.1 清理系统缓存
系统会创建各种缓存文件以提高性能,但这些文件可能会占用大量磁盘空间。可以使用以下命令清理系统缓存:
sudo rm -rf /var/cache/*
这个命令将删除/var/cache目录下的所有缓存文件。
5.2 清理浏览器缓存
浏览器缓存文件可能会占用大量磁盘空间。您可以在浏览器的设置中清理缓存,或使用以下命令删除缓存文件:
rm -rf ~/.cache/
这个命令将删除当前用户的浏览器缓存文件。
6. 清理无效软件包
系统中的无效软件包可能会占用大量磁盘空间。可以使用以下命令来清除无效软件包:
sudo apt autoremove
这个命令将自动删除不再需要的软件包和其依赖项。
7. 小结
定期清理垃圾文件是确保Linux系统正常运行的重要任务。本文介绍了如何检查磁盘空间、清理临时文件、清理日志文件、清理缓存文件和清理无效软件包。
通过执行这些清理步骤,您可以确保系统始终处于最佳状态,提高性能并释放磁盘空间。